Transaction 572fa0f8aa766aa98a7a74dddc3a004db119b1a354ce578ef8e4d4945fc99ba3
1 Input
1 Output
-
572fa0f8aa766aa98a7a74dddc3a004db119b1a354ce578ef8e4d4945fc99ba3:0
- value
- 16663897
- script pubkey
- OP_0 OP_PUSHBYTES_32 13f8d8c3d67526d3c949233053c5dcfa6e69f29979e2a18fe7cd48f36926bee8
- address
- bc1qz0ud3s7kw5nd8j2fyvc983wulfhxnu5e0832rrl8e4y0x6fxhm5qpuxyps